This video shows Loïc Jean-Albert proximity flying over the rolling cliffs of Norway. That guy narrarating is JT Holmes. Both of these guys are visionaries and both aggressively push the boundaries of their sport. JT Holmes has been skiing most of his life and Loïc Jean-Albert has 11,000 jumps in skydiving and over 1,000 base jumps. He is mostly known for his wingsuit flying performances. His popular alias… The Flying Dude.
